Define the engineering decision

The central decision is which process variables, material documents, geometry and evidence must be defined before a project process window is discussed. Translate the part into a controlled geometry brief

The geometry brief should identify part thickness, contours, interfaces, thermal mass, support zones, exposed surfaces and drawing-controlled conditions. 01Can a published page define a process window for every project?

No. A process window must be established from the applicable material, actual geometry, process equipment, documentation and project validation evidence.

02What should be sent for a process-window discussion?

Send the proposed process route, controlled geometry, material documents, profile or sequence, open risks, records and required validation decision.
